point and plug gap on v-6
 
Can someone tell me what the point and spark plug gap is on a 305 v-6? Thanks!

Spark Plugs Gap;
305A, 305B & 305D -- 0.030"
305E & 305C 0.035"
351, 401, & 478 0.030"

Source: http://www.6066gmcguy.com/EngineData.html
